A Software Engineer should be proficient in at least one major programming language like Java, Python, or JavaScript, along with familiarity with frameworks like React, Node.js, or Angular depending on the role.
Software Engineers typically start as Junior Developers, progress to Mid-level and Senior roles, and can advance to Technical Lead, Engineering Manager, or Architect positions with experience and leadership skills.
Key responsibilities include designing and developing software applications, writing clean and maintainable code, collaborating with cross-functional teams, debugging issues, participating in code reviews, and staying updated with emerging technologies.
